Windows系统教程|电脑软件安装与优化指南|系统设置/故障排查/性能提升

win10学习c语言用什么软件(win10下有什么好的c语言开发软件)

2025-12-11 06:45:02 来源:创始人

嘿,朋友们!👋 作为一名在编程圈摸爬滚打多年的老司机,我深知新手在选择第一个编程软件时的迷茫和纠结。特别是当你刚装好Windows 10系统,面对网上琳琅满目的编程工具推荐,简直像走进了一个迷宫,不知道该往哪个方向走。😵

今天就让我带你走出这个困境,帮你找到那个最适合你的"编程初恋"!💖

为什么选对第一个编程软件这么重要?

还记得我第一次接触编程时的情景吗?当时我花了整整三天时间在各种软件的安装和配置上折腾,结果连一个简单的"Hello World"都没能顺利运行出来。那种挫败感,现在想起来都觉得心疼当时的自己。💔

选对软件能让你:

  • 少走弯路‌:避开复杂的配置过程
  • 快速上手‌:专注于学习编程本身
  • 保持热情‌:避免被技术问题浇灭学习兴趣

那么,Win10系统下到底有哪些值得推荐的编程软件呢?让我一一为你道来!

Visual Studio:专业选手的终极武器 🚀

说到Windows平台下的编程软件,Visual Studio绝对是绕不开的明星产品。这款由微软自家打造的IDE(集成开发环境),可以说是为Windows系统量身定做的。✨

VS的强大之处在于:

  • 智能代码提示‌:就像有个贴心小助手在旁边帮你写代码
  • 强大的调试功能‌:帮你快速定位和解决bug
  • 丰富的扩展生态‌:想要什么功能,基本上都能找到对应的插件

我记得刚开始用VS的时候,最让我惊喜的是它的代码自动补全功能。有时候我只需要输入几个字母,它就能猜出我想要写什么,大大提高了编码效率。📈

VS也有个小缺点——体积有点大。安装包动辄几个G,安装时间也比较长。但话说回来,现在的硬盘空间都那么大了,这点"体重"应该不成问题吧?😉

Dev-C++:轻量级选手的贴心选择 🎯

如果你觉得Visual Studio太重量级了,那Dev-C++绝对值得你考虑。这款软件特别适合初学者,它的安装包只有几十兆,几分钟就能搞定安装。⚡

Dev-C++的三大优势:

  1. 安装简单‌:一键安装,基本不需要额外配置
  2. 运行快速‌:启动速度比VS快不少
  3. 学习成本低‌:界面简洁,功能直观

我有个朋友就是通过Dev-C++入门编程的,他说这款软件让他能够专注于学习C语言语法,而不是在环境配置上浪费时间。

Code::Blocks:跨平台的全能选手 🌍

Code::Blocks是一款开源的C/C++ IDE,它的最大特点是跨平台支持。这意味着你今天在Win10上写的代码,明天拿到Linux系统上也能顺利运行。🔄

为什么推荐Code::Blocks?

  • 支持多种编译器(GCC、Clang、Visual C++等)
  • 插件架构让功能扩展变得容易
  • 界面虽然简单,但该有的功能一个不少

Visual Studio Code:现代开发的潮流之选 💫

VSCode可以说是近年来最受欢迎的代码编辑器之一。它轻量、快速,而且功能强大到让人惊喜!🎉

VSCode的亮点功能:

  • 海量扩展‌:几乎支持所有编程语言
  • 集成终端‌:不用在编辑器和控制台之间来回切换
  • Git集成‌:版本控制变得so easy

我现在的日常开发工作基本上都在VSCode上进行,它的响应速度和扩展生态真的让我爱不释手。❤️

新手常见问题答疑 🤔

Q:我是完全零基础,应该选哪个软件?
A:推荐从‌Dev-C++‌开始,它足够简单,能让你快速进入编程状态。

Q:想要往专业方向发展,哪个软件更合适?
A:‌Visual Studio‌或‌VSCode‌都是不错的选择,它们能陪伴你从入门到精通。

Q:这些软件收费吗?
A:放心,上面提到的软件都有免费版本,完全能满足学习需求。💰

各软件对比一览表 📊

为了让你更直观地了解这些软件的特点,我特意整理了一个对比表格:

软件名称 适合人群 安装大小 学习难度 功能丰富度
Visual Studio 专业开发者/进阶学习者 2-3GB 中等 ⭐⭐⭐⭐⭐
Dev-C++ 完全新手/学生 50MB左右 简单 ⭐⭐⭐
Code::Blocks 跨平台开发者 100MB左右 中等 ⭐⭐⭐⭐
VSCode 所有级别开发者 100MB左右 中等 ⭐⭐⭐⭐⭐

我的个人使用心得 💭

经过这么多年的编程生涯,我用过各种各样的开发工具。说实话,没有哪个软件是完美无缺的,关键是找到适合你当前阶段的那一个。

给新手的建议:

  • 不要纠结‌:选一个先用起来,重要的是开始写代码
  • 循序渐进‌:可以从简单的Dev-C++开始,等熟练后再换更强大的工具
  • 多尝试‌:不同的软件有不同的特点,找到最顺手的那款

我记得当初从Dev-C++切换到VSCode的时候,那种体验的提升真的让人感动。就好像从自行车换到了跑车,虽然都需要你亲自驾驶,但体验完全不在一个级别上。🏎️

最后想说,选择编程软件就像选择一双合脚的鞋子,别人说再好也不如你自己试穿来得实在。希望我的分享能帮你找到属于你的那双"编程战靴"!👟

记住,最好的软件,是那个能让你愉快地写代码的软件!Happy Coding!🎊

免责声明:本站所有文章和图片均来自用户分享和网络收集,文章和图片版权归原作者及原出处所有,仅供学习与参考,请勿用于商业用途,如果损害了您的权利,请联系网站客服处理。

相关文章

  • win10支持kx驱动哪个版本(win10安装kx驱动教程)
    win10支持kx驱动哪个版本(win10安装kx驱动教程)

    你的专业声卡在Win10上"罢工"了吗?🎤 作为一名玩了十几年音频设备的老烧友,我完全理解那种花大价钱买了专业声卡,却在最新系统上无法使用的郁闷心情!特别是关于‌win10支持kx驱动哪个版本‌的问题,以及详细的‌win10安装kx驱动教程‌,今天我就来帮你彻底解决这些烦人的兼容性问题! 说实话,我...

    2025-12-11 06:45:02
  • win10紧急更新关闭方法(win10更新提示怎么消除)
    win10紧急更新关闭方法(win10更新提示怎么消除)

    win10紧急更新关闭方法(win10更新提示怎么消除) 💻 正在专心工作时,突然弹出的"紧急更新"提示是不是让你瞬间血压升高?那种被迫中断工作、眼睁睁看着系统重启的无力感,相信每个Win10用户都深有体会。今天我就来分享几个亲测有效的方法,帮你彻底摆脱这个烦恼! 为什么Win10老是提示紧急更新?...

    2025-12-11 06:45:02
  • win10适合的入门级游戏显卡(台式电脑win10显卡推荐2024)
    win10适合的入门级游戏显卡(台式电脑win10显卡推荐2024)

    哎呀,想给台式电脑换个显卡,却不知道WIN10系统到底该选哪款?😵 作为一个在电脑硬件堆里摸爬滚打多年的数码博主,今天就来帮你彻底搞懂win10显卡选择的那些事儿!显卡选择前的系统检查:别急着下单!首先要弄清楚你的电脑到底能装什么显卡。根据我的经验,盲目购买是最大的坑!电源功率确认至关重要💡:检查当...

    2025-12-11 06:45:02
  • win10独占游戏啥意思?有啥好处?
    win10独占游戏啥意思?有啥好处?

    你是不是也好奇,为啥有些游戏只能在win10上玩?🤔 朋友推荐了个新游戏,结果发现是"win10独占",心里直犯嘀咕:这到底啥意思?买了会不会亏?别急,今天我就带你一探究竟!咱不光解释清楚win10独占游戏是啥,还聊聊它到底有啥好处——比如性能提升、省钱妙招,顺带教你开启win10自带的虚拟机来试试...

    2025-12-11 06:45:02
  • win10 1079版本特性究竟如何?实测兼容性与用户评价揭秘
    win10 1079版本特性究竟如何?实测兼容性与用户评价揭秘

    🤔 初识win10 1079:这是个什么版本?很多小伙伴在搜索"win10 1079"时都是一头雾水,其实这就是Windows 10秋季创意者更新的版本代号。该版本于2017年9月正式推送,版本号锁定在1709,是Win10历史上一个重要的里程碑。版本基本信息发布周期:2017年9月正式上线内部版本...

    2025-12-11 06:45:02